open class StickerToolPanel : AbstractToolPanel, DataSourceListAdapter.OnItemClickListener<AbstractIdItem!>, DataSourceArrayList.Callback
Tool view a Stickers
StickerToolPanel(stateHandler: StateHandler!) |
static var STICKER_PICKER_INTENT: Intent! |
|
static val TOOL_ID: String |
static val ANIMATION_DURATION: Int |
|
var historySettings: Array<Class<out Settings<Enum<*>!>!>!>! |
|
var parentView: ViewGroup! |
|
var toolHistoryLevel: Int |
|
var toolView: AbstractToolPanel.ToolView! |
|
var uiDensity: Float |
open fun attachSticker(config: ImageStickerAsset!): Unit |
|
open fun beforeListItemRemoved(data: MutableList<Any?>!, index: Int): Unit |
|
open fun beforeListItemsRemoved(data: MutableList<Any?>!, from: Int, to: Int): Unit |
|
open fun chooseSticker(imageStickerAsset: ImageStickerAsset!): Unit |
|
open fun createExitAnimator(panelView: View!): Animator! |
|
open fun createShowAnimator(panelView: View!): Animator! |
|
open fun getHistorySettings(): Array<Class<out Settings<Enum<*>!>!>!>! |
|
open fun getLayoutResource(): Int |
|
open fun listInvalid(data: MutableList<Any?>!): Unit |
|
open fun listItemAdded(data: MutableList<Any?>!, index: Int): Unit |
|
open fun listItemChanged(data: MutableList<Any?>!, index: Int): Unit |
|
open fun listItemRemoved(data: MutableList<Any?>!, index: Int): Unit |
|
open fun listItemsAdded(data: MutableList<Any?>!, from: Int, to: Int): Unit |
|
open fun listItemsRemoved(data: MutableList<Any?>!, from: Int, to: Int): Unit |
|
open fun onAttached(context: Context!, panelView: View!): Unit |
|
open fun onBeforeDetach(panelView: View!, revertChanges: Boolean): Int |
|
open fun onDetached(): Unit |
|
open fun onItemClick(entity: AbstractIdItem!): Unit |
|
open fun useGalleryUploadAction(): Unit |
fun attach(parentView: ViewGroup!): View! |
|
fun callAttached(context: Context!, panelView: View!): Unit |
|
fun detach(revertChanges: Boolean): Unit |
|
open fun equals(other: Any?): Boolean |
|
open fun feature(): Feature! |
|
open fun getActivity(): ImgLyActivity! |
|
open fun getConfig(): AssetConfig! |
|
open fun getHistoryLevel(): Int |
|
open fun getHistoryState(): HistoryState! |
|
open fun getPanelView(): View! |
|
open fun getStateHandler(): StateHandler! |
|
open fun hashCode(): Int |
|
open fun isAcceptable(): Boolean |
|
open fun isAttached(): Boolean |
|
open fun isCancelable(): Boolean |
|
open fun isInited(): Boolean |
|
open fun isReady(): Boolean |
|
open fun onDetach(): Unit |
|
open fun redoLocalState(): Unit |
|
open fun refresh(): Unit |
|
open fun revertChanges(): Unit |
|
open fun revertToInitialState(): Unit |
|
open fun saveEndState(): Unit |
|
open fun saveInitialState(): Unit |
|
open fun saveLocalState(): Unit |
|
fun setupHistory(): Unit |
|
open fun toString(): String |
|
open fun undoLocalState(): Unit |
|
open fun updateStageOverlapping(bottomScreenPos: Int): Unit |